WebThen the Shannon limit may be expressed as SNRnorm > 1 (0 dB). Moreover, the value of SNR norm in dB measures how far a given coding scheme is operating from the Shannon limit, in dB (the “gap to capacity”). WebThat’s a mouthful, so in simpler terms, the Shannon limit is the theoretical limit to how much you throughput you can get from a wireless channel given a specified bandwidth and signal to noise ratio. Examples At a Signal to Noise Ratio of 0 where Signal Power = Noise Power, the channel capacity in bits per second equals the bandwidht in Hertz. During the late 1920s, Harry Nyquist and Ralph Hartley developed a handful of fundamental ideas related to the transmission of information, particularly in the context of the telegraph as a communications system. At the time, these concepts were powerful breakthroughs individually, but they were not part of a comprehensive theory.
